If I just want to slap together a simple midi, I use Power Tab Editor. It is, for all intents and purposes, a tablature editor for guitar or bass. But it has a feature that allows you to play a midi of the song you've tabbed out, so you can see how it sounds. You can also change the sound of the instrument during playback to, say, a piano or koto etc, and then export the midi itself. It does take a little bit of general music knowledge, such as notes, rests, rhythm slashes, etc.
